What to Eat

Edible parts: Leaves, Fruit

The leaves can be cooked and eaten, but this is considered a famine food, used only when nothing else is available.

Where to Find It

It is a subtropical plant. It grows in sparse or dense forests between 100-1,800 m above sea level in southern China. In Sichuan and Yunnan.

How to Identify

A shrub. It keeps its leaves during the year. It grows 4 m tall. The current year's branches are 4 sided. The leaves are opposite and 4-12 cm long by 3-5 cm wide. They have small brown dots underneath. The flowers are in a compound group at the ends of the branches. The fruit are red when mature. They are 3-6 mm across.

How to Grow

An easily grown plant, it succeeds in most soils but is ill-adapted for poor soils and for dry situations. It prefers a deep rich loamy soil in sun or semi-shade. Best if given shade from the early morning sun in spring. Not very frost tolerant, this species is only likely to succeed outdoors in the very mildest areas of the country. Plants are self-incompatible and need to grow close to a genetically distinct plant in the same species in order to produce fruit and fertile seed.

Propagation: Seed is best sown in a cold frame as soon as it is ripe. Germination can be slow, sometimes taking more than 18 months. Seed harvested green — fully developed but not yet fully ripe — and sown immediately in a cold frame should germinate the following spring. Stored seed needs 2 months of warm stratification followed by 3 months of cold, and may still take 18 months to germinate. Prick seedlings into individual pots when large enough to handle, grow on in a cold frame or greenhouse, and plant out in late spring or early summer of the following year. Softwood cuttings taken in early summer in a frame should be potted individually once rooting begins and planted out the following late spring or early summer. Half-ripe cuttings, 5–8 cm long with a heel if possible, taken in July or August in a frame should be potted as soon as they start to root. These can be difficult to overwinter and are best kept under glass until the following spring. Mature wood cuttings taken in winter in a frame should root in early spring; pot when large enough and plant out in summer if sufficient new growth has been made, otherwise overwinter in a cold frame and plant out the following spring. Layering of the current season's growth in July or August takes 15 months.

An evergreen shrub reaching 5 m tall. Hardy to UK zone 9 but frost tender. Maintains foliage year-round. Hermaphroditic flowers are insect-pollinated but not self-fertile. Tolerates light, medium, and heavy soils with pH from mildly acidic to mildly alkaline. Can grow in semi-shade or full sun, preferring moist soil.
